Only 503,000 tourists visited Egypt in August 2016: CAPMAS
The number of tourist arrivals from all countries reached 503,000 during August 2016 compared to 915,200 tourists during August 2015, a decrease of 45%, according to the Central Agency for Public Mobilization and Statistics (CAPMAS). G7 sets common cyber-safety guidelines for financial sector
The Group of Seven industrial powers yesterday said they had agreed on guidelines for protecting the global financial sector from cyber attacks following a series of cross-border bank thefts by hackers. Putin shuns Paris visit after France offers talks only on Syria
Russian President Vladimir Putin will not come to Paris next week after declining to meet President Francois Hollande only for talks on Syria, a source in Hollande’s office said, the latest deterioration in ties between Moscow and the West. Escalation in Syria means EU less likely to soften stance on Russia
Outraged by Russia’s intensified air strikes on rebels in Syria, the European Union is now less likely to ease sanctions on Moscow over Ukraine, diplomats say, and some in the bloc are raising the prospect of more punitive steps against the Kremlin. Syrian Dina Sheikh Ali wins five medals at Arab Rhythmic Gymnastics Championship
Kiev, SANA – The Syrian expatriate and athlete Dina Sheikh Ali ranked second at the Arab Rhythmic Gymnastics championship held in Tunisia in the beginning of October 2016.
